Dodgers Wrap up Regular Season With Six-Game NL West Homestand

LOS ANGELES – The back-to-back World Series champion Los Angeles Dodgers return to UNIQLO Field at Dodger Stadium tomorrow after clinching their fifth straight National League West title and their 13th in the last 14 years earlier today in Cincinnati. Highlighted by three promotional giveaways, two drone shows and La Gran Fiesta, the Dodgers welcome two familiar opponents in San Francisco (Sept. 18-20) and San Diego (Sept. 22-24) during their last regular season home games of the year. Auto gates will open for each game two and half hours prior to first pitch, with stadium gates opening two hours before the start of the game. Fans are encouraged to utilize Metro’s Dodger Stadium Express (DSE) to get to and from the ballpark. The shuttle service is free for all ticket holders and begins operation three hours before first pitch from Union Station and the Harbor Gateway Transit Center. The DSE will operate three hours prior to first pitch. Uber, the Dodgers’ official rideshare program, will continue to be an additional alternative of getting to UNIQLO Field at Dodger Stadium. The rideshare service will enter through Gate B, off of Stadium Way, to pick up and drop off riders in Lot 1, to allow a smoother entry and exit experience. The Los Angeles Dodgers franchise, with nine World Series championships and 26 National League pennants since its beginnings in Brooklyn in 1890, is committed to a tradition of pride and excellence. The Dodgers, baseball’s 2024 and 2025 back-to-back World Champions, are the reigning Sports Business Journal Sports Team of the Year, have been recognized as ESPN’s Sports Humanitarian Team of the Year and are dedicated to supporting a culture of winning baseball, providing a first-class, fan-friendly experience, and building a strong partnership with the community. With the highest cumulative fan attendance in Major League Baseball history and a record of breaking barriers, the Dodgers are one of the most cherished sports franchises in the world.
